From b1963f736e7f6f5bda969fafcde0cf815367cb1f Mon Sep 17 00:00:00 2001 From: Wagner Maciel Date: Mon, 15 Dec 2025 15:32:54 -0500 Subject: [PATCH 1/2] docs(aria/tree): improve disabled ui --- src/components-examples/aria/tree/tree-common.css | 14 ++++++++++++++ 1 file changed, 14 insertions(+) diff --git a/src/components-examples/aria/tree/tree-common.css b/src/components-examples/aria/tree/tree-common.css index 643fb5ab385d..855f854c0072 100644 --- a/src/components-examples/aria/tree/tree-common.css +++ b/src/components-examples/aria/tree/tree-common.css @@ -21,6 +21,20 @@ min-width: 24rem; } +.example-tree[aria-disabled='true'] { + background-color: var(--mat-sys-surface-variant); + color: var(--mat-sys-on-surface-variant); + cursor: default; +} + +.example-tree[aria-disabled='true']:focus-within { + outline: 2px solid var(--mat-sys-primary); +} + +.example-tree[aria-disabled='true'] .example-tree-item { + pointer-events: none; +} + .example-tree-item { cursor: pointer; list-style: none; From 8d8002b8a59b9e1418421021e2fc07d0b3fc4f97 Mon Sep 17 00:00:00 2001 From: Wagner Maciel Date: Tue, 16 Dec 2025 10:53:20 -0500 Subject: [PATCH 2/2] fixup! docs(aria/tree): improve disabled ui --- src/components-examples/aria/tree/tree-common.css |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/components-examples/aria/tree/tree-common.css b/src/components-examples/aria/tree/tree-common.css index 855f854c0072..959a7f065b39 100644 --- a/src/components-examples/aria/tree/tree-common.css +++ b/src/components-examples/aria/tree/tree-common.css @@ -24,7 +24,7 @@ .example-tree[aria-disabled='true'] { background-color: var(--mat-sys-surface-variant); color: var(--mat-sys-on-surface-variant); - cursor: default; + cursor: not-allowed; } .example-tree[aria-disabled='true']:focus-within {